Bellevue College men’s golf kicked off the spring portion of their season with a huge win against several four year universities by taking the South Puget Sound Invitational at Tumwater Valley Golf Course. The Bulldogs shot +15 for the two days going nine over on Sat. Apr. 12 then improving to six over on Sun. Apr. 13. Bellevue edged runner up Whitworth University by three strokes. Freshman Isaac Elaimy took home medalist honors with rounds of 69-70 for a five-under total. Elaimy started and ended his round with birdies for the title. Milo Stover finished tied for seventh at five over (73-76). Sophomore Matthew Davidson and Kai Lambro finished tied for tenth at eight over par. Davidson fired a 72 on the final day.

The tourney featured Whitworth, Pacific Lutheran, and University of Puget Sound; all four year universities, in addition to Olympic College and South Puget Sound Community College.
